Climate Overview
Bangalore
Bangalore sits on the Deccan Plateau at an average elevation of 900 meters, giving it a notably mild tropical climate that earns it the nickname 'Garden City' despite rapid urbanization. The city's temperature is moderated by its altitude, but the explosive growth of IT corridors and concrete infrastructure has created stark microclimate differences between the leafy old cantonment areas and the dense new development zones. Seasonal weather is driven by both the southwest and northeast monsoons, with the city's network of historical lakes (tanks) and remaining tree canopy playing critical roles in local cooling and humidity patterns.
Cairo
Hot desert — very hot dry summers, mild winters, virtually no rainfall
Cairo is one of the world's largest cities in one of the world's driest climates. Rain is essentially absent. Summers are brutally hot and dusty; winters are mild and perfect for sightseeing. The khamsin (hot desert wind) brings sandstorms in spring.
